                                Studies suggest that malnutrition is prevalent in up to 50% of hospitalized patients, increasing the need for effective nutritional support like Total Parenteral Nutrition (TPN). To confirm if this therapy is working, healthcare professionals rely on a specific lab value, prealbumin, to provide evidence that the TPN is effective in improving the client's nutritional status.
